Microstructures and Properties of Abrasion-Resistant Cobalt-Base Alloy K-C20WN Prepared by Centrifugal Casting
Abstract:
The abrasion-resistant cobalt-base alloy K-C20WN was prepared by centrifugal casting and the effects of centrifugal temperature and speed on the microstructures and the performances of the casting were researched. The results showed that the microstructures of the casting consist of the loose equiaxed crystal, the dense equiaxed crystal, and the columnar dendrite from outside to inside. The centrifugal pouring temperature and rotational speed affects the performances apparently. Low temperature and high rotational speed help to enhance comprehensive mechnical performances of the alloys. And the improvement mechanism was also discussed in this paper.
